Cengage is on a mission to make every student a confident learner, and we are looking for a Lead Digital Product Analytics to help achieve that goal.   

Role Overview:

We are seeking an experienced Lead/Director Product Analytics to be responsible for the evolution of our product intelligence and experimentation capability across Cengage’s digital portfolio. Reporting to the leader of the Product Analytics team, this individual will build and scale a modern analytics function that influences product strategy, improves learner outcomes, and fuels the next wave of digital innovation across the enterprise.   

You will lead a high-performing team of product analytics scientists, partner closely with Product, Technology, Marketing, Business partners and serve as a leader with vision on digital learning intelligence and student engagement measurement. This role blends strategic vision, analytical difficulty, and hands-on leadership to elevate Cengage’s digital product decisions and culture of experimentation.  

What You’ll Do Here:

In this role you will help Cengage set up our product analytics practice. Work with product and technology teams to understand customer needs. Use Amplitude and other analytics tools to tag the full digital experience. Gather appropriate data and build metrics and insights. You will work closely with product owners to identify what parts of the digital customer experience need to be changed, set up A/B tests to identify customer response to product changes and measure the business value and customer satisfaction delivered by the digital product.  

The ideal candidate is an expert analytical and process improvement professional, with experience in data-driven decision making and Digital clickstream data, product analytics concepts with ideally some exposure to digital marketing and data science. You will lead a team of analysts and data scientists, collaborating with various partners in global businesses on important analytics and product tasks.  

Are you motivated by working to refine analytical capability in established businesses, while bringing standard methodologies and analytical horsepower to more up-and-coming ones? Reporting to the Head of Product Analytics, you will help bring this strategic process thinking and continual improvement to Cengage’s global businesses.  

What You’ll Do

  • Develop and implement the enterprise product analytics strategy aligned to Cengage’s learning and product vision

  • Lead and mentor a team of analysts and data scientists, embedding best-in-class practices in experimentation, measurement, and insight generation

  • Drive end-to-end instrumentation strategy, partnering with tech teams to ensure scalable, accurate, and consistent tracking across platforms and experiences

  • Champion a customer-focused product culture, turning data into actionable stories and strategic recommendations

  • Partner with product and design leadership to shape product roadmaps advised by learning science, behavioral signal analysis, and student outcome metrics

  • Lead the design and governance of A/B testing and experimentation frameworks to evaluate features, optimize experience flow, and validate product hypotheses

  • Operationalize product health dashboards, KPI frameworks, and executive-ready insights to track success and guide strategic tradeoffs

  • Collaborate closely with data engineering/platform teams to ensure robust data pipelines, semantic layer consistency, and scalable analytic infrastructure

  • Influence digital architecture direction for next-generation learning signals, engagement models, and LTV-style student value frameworks

  • Serve as a senior thought partner to business units on sophisticated analytics, segmentation, and predictive modeling approaches

  • Build readiness and maturity around analytics enablement, training product and business stakeholders on data literacy and measurement excellence.  

Who You Are:

  • Strategic leader with 8+ years in product analytics, digital analytics, or data science, including 3+ years managing high-performing teams

  • Experience scaling analytics teams and capabilities in a digital product or software-based environment

  • Sophisticated knowledge of product analytics tools (Amplitude, Adobe Analytics, etc.) and cloud and data platforms (Snowflake, AWS, Databricks, etc.)

  • Proven track record of building experimentation programs, KPI frameworks, and translating insights into product and customer experience improvements

  • Strong storytelling ability with executive presence — able to synthesize sophisticated data into compelling narratives

  • Proficient with SQL, Python and/or R, and data visualization tools (Power BI, etc.)

  • Deep knowledge of digital engagement, funnel optimization, and behavioral analytics.

About Cengage Group

Cengage Group, a global education technology company serving millions of learners, provides affordable, quality digital products and services that equip students with the skills and competencies needed to be job ready. For more than 100 years, we have enabled the power and joy of learning with trusted, engaging content, and now, integrated digital platforms. We serve the higher education, workforce skills, secondary education, English language teaching and research markets worldwide. Through our scalable technology, including MindTap and Cengage Unlimited, we support all learners who seek to improve their lives and achieve their dreams through education.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
